Abstract
A kind of combined energy-saving device, integration degree is high for it, equipment occupation space can be saved, reduce equipment cost, it includes economizer header, condenser header, collect tank shell, economizer header, condenser header is vertically arranged in parallel in collection tank shell, collect tank shell and the side of economizer header is provided with gas inlet, the collection tank shell other side is provided with exhanst gas outlet, the two sides of economizer header are respectively arranged with economizer header import, the outlet of economizer header, the two sides of condenser header are respectively arranged with condenser header import, the outlet of condenser header, economizer header, the bottom end two sides of condenser header are respectively arranged with header drain port.

Background technique
In face of Global climate change and energy crisis, international community is held to realize Economic Development Mode transformation and fulfiling
Specific energy consumption is greatly reduced in promise, national requirements, and to energy conservation, more stringent requirements are proposed, and therefore, present boiler is typically necessary
Install energy-saving appliance additional.But traditional energy-saving appliance integrated level is lower, generallys use economizer and condenser and column is individually divided to arrange
Arrangement connection flue is needed among structure, economizer and condenser so that equipment occupation space area greatly increases, while equipment at
This is also relatively high.
Utility model content
For the problems such as integrated level existing in the prior art is low, equipment occupation space is big, equipment cost is high, this is practical new
Type provides a kind of combined energy-saving device, and integration degree is big, can save equipment occupation space, reduce equipment cost.

Using the above structure of the utility model, economizer header, condenser header are arranged in same collection tank shell,
The structure for individually dividing column to arrange compared to economizer header, condenser header, is greatly saved equipment occupation space, and economizer
Without arranging connection flue between header, condenser header, equipment cost is thus greatly reduced;Due to economizer in the present apparatus
Header, condenser header are respectively arranged with the import of economizer header, the outlet of economizer header, the import of condenser header, condenser
Header outlet, therefore can be that a system uses by economizer header, condenser header serial or parallel connection according to user's needs,
In addition it can also be required that energy-saving appliance is applied in combination according to user, when meeting exhaust gas temperature, can be used alone economizer header
Or condenser header.
